The Return of the Two-Way Wonder: Shohei Ohtani's Resilience and Impact on the Dodgers

The Los Angeles Dodgers' star player, Shohei Ohtani, made a triumphant return to the lineup on Saturday, June 13, 2026, after a brief absence due to left knee inflammation. This comeback story highlights Ohtani's remarkable resilience and the significant impact he has on the team's performance.

A Precautionary Measure

Ohtani's absence from the previous game against the Pittsburgh Pirates was a precautionary measure, as imaging showed no abnormalities. However, the Dodgers' decision to rest him for the following day's game against the White Sox showcased their commitment to his long-term health and the importance of his two-way abilities. This strategic approach to managing Ohtani's workload is a testament to the team's forward-thinking and cautious management style.

The Two-Way Superstar

Ohtani's return to the lineup on Saturday was a much-anticipated event, as he has been a key factor in the Dodgers' success this season. As a designated hitter, he leads the National League with a .421 on-base percentage, showcasing his exceptional batting skills. With 13 home runs and 40 RBIs, Ohtani is a force to be reckoned with at the plate. His ability to contribute both offensively and defensively makes him a unique and invaluable asset to the team.

On the mound, Ohtani's performance is equally impressive. He has a 6-2 record with a 1.06 ERA, which would be the best in the National League if he qualified. His pitching prowess, combined with his hitting abilities, makes him a two-way player like no other in Major League Baseball.
